The average train between Liverpool and Ashford takes 3h 14m and the fastest train takes 3h 1m. There is an hourly train service from Liverpool to Ashford.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Trains run hourly between Liverpool and Ashford. The earliest departure is at 5:25 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Liverpool is at 8:51 PM which arrives into Ashford at 12:50 AM. All services require a transfer at London Euston and take an average of 3h 14m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ct train from Liverpool to Ashford. However, there are services departing from Liverpool station and arriving at Ashford station via London Euston.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 14m.
Liverpool to Ashford train services, operated by Avanti West Coast, depart from Liverpool Lime Street station.
Liverpool to Ashford train services, operated by Avanti West Coast, arrive at Ashford International station.

The distance between Liverpool and Ashford is 363.3 km. The road distance is 400 km.
You can take a train from Liverpool Lime Street to Ashford International via London Euston and London St Pancras Intl in around 3h 28m.
